Business Class from Chicago to Monterrey
Monterrey draws a distinct mix of travelers compared to Mexico's beach destinations. This is Mexico's industrial capital, home to steel, automotive, and tech manufacturing along with a growing number of multinational corporate offices, which means the passenger mix on Chicago to Monterrey business class flights leans heavily corporate. Executives visiting plants in the Nuevo León industrial corridor, engineers on project work, and increasingly remote-work professionals based in Monterrey's tech scene fill these cabins alongside leisure travelers headed to the Sierra Madre mountains and the city's surprisingly good food and craft beer culture.

Airlines & Cabin Experience
Because Monterrey doesn't have widebody service directly from Chicago, most premium itineraries route through a connecting hub. American typically routes through Dallas-Fort Worth, where you'll often catch a Flagship Business flight on the DFW-MTY sector or at minimum a well-appointed regional cabin, with the long-haul feel coming from the domestic connection experience and Flagship Lounge access in DFW. Delta usually connects through Atlanta, and if your itinerary includes any longer domestic or international leg, you may land in a Delta One Suite with a closing door, though on the shorter MTY connection you're more likely in first class. LATAM's Mexico network sometimes routes through Mexico City or even Bogotá depending on availability, and if you're rebooked onto a longer LATAM segment, their 2-2-2 lie-flat product is worth requesting specifically.

Pricing & Best Time to Fly
Given the connection-heavy nature of Chicago to Monterrey business class routings, pricing swings more than you'd expect for a sub-8-hour total travel time. Our fares run $1,700 to $5,200 round-trip depending on which airline, cabin, and connection combination you land on. The lower end typically reflects domestic first class paired with a short regional business cabin, while the top of the range gets you genuine lie-flat product on at least one long-haul segment. January through March and again in November and December tend to offer the best value, largely because Monterrey's business travel calendar slows around US holidays and Mexican school breaks shift demand elsewhere. June and July also see softer fares as summer leisure demand favors coastal Mexico over an inland industrial city.

Travel Tips
On the ground, Monterrey's airport (MTY) is compact and efficient, and immigration is generally quick for US citizens. If you're connecting through DFW, budget extra time during peak evening banks when the terminal gets congested. Pack layers regardless of season, since Monterrey sits at higher elevation than coastal Mexico and evenings can be cool even in summer.
